Common to Tour With John Legend, De La Soul

With Be having just hit stores, Common is promoting the absolute shit out of it. For the next week or so he'll be in record shops on the East Coast signing copies of the new album and just generally spreading good, soulful vibes. I've never met the man but I imagine he's probably like the sagest dude you've ever seen, so maybe actually buy a copy of the new record (it's good) since he can't sign your hard drive. Com's just about to do a short headlining tour, with a few hometown shows in Chicago, to supplement the in-stores before heading out on a larger summer tour. As previously reported, he's also taking part in the Music Midtown Festival in Atlanta on June 11. Solo dates:

Okay, but we're not done yet, because this is like a double-edged news story. See, it turns out that John Legend is going to be setting out on his first major headlining tour of the U.S. and he's bringing De La Soul, Rahzel, and Common along for part of the ride. With Legend's album selling quite well, he's not fucking around: more than two months of shows, and he's headlining the entire thing. Common's even opening for him in Chicago! Blasphemy:
